Marathon program

8 weeks — from portrait to figure, from simple to complex

Every week: lecture (Tuesday 21:55) and feedback stream (Saturday 21:00)

Portrait sketches
Week 1Layout and spots

Portrait sketches

We learn how to compose a portrait on a sheet, work in large spots and look for character from the first strokes.

Eyes, lips, nose, ear
Week 2Face Details

Eyes, lips, nose, ear

We analyze the design and plasticity of each element of the face — from simplified shapes to expressive details.

Portrait
Week 3Image and emotions

Portrait

Putting it together: proportions, light, character. Drawing a completed portrait with a mood

The hands
Week 4Sign language

The hands

The hands are the most expressive part of the figure after the face. Construction, camera angles, gestures

Feet
Week 5Structure and anatomy

Feet

We analyze the device of the foot, learn how to draw from different angles and positions.

Sketches of a female figure
Week 6Plastics and dynamics

Sketches of a female figure

We capture the plasticity and rhythm of the female figure through quick sketches — from 30 seconds to 5 minutes.

Sketches of the male figure
Week 7Anatomy and great movement

Sketches of the male figure

We work with the male figure: mass, structure, dynamics. Emphasis on big movement

Figure
Week 8Long-term sketching

Figure

Final week: long-term figure drawing with attention to anatomy, proportions and details

Azat Nurgaleev — marathon host

Marathon host

Azat Nurgaleev

Artist, founder and ideologist of Skills Up School

Graduate of the Stieglitz Academy of Art and Industry, Communicative Design. Drawing the human figure became the main theme in Azat’s work back in the academy.

Drawing mentor — A.S. Spitsin. Additional painting courses with S.P. Mosevich. Teaches drawing fundamentals since the third year at the academy. Trained thousands of students — from beginners to advanced level.

Works at the intersection of traditional and digital art — from academic drawing to bold stylization. With the team, created the comic "Stars" in an edition of 1000 copies.
